Trial balance of:

Transactions:

1 - The owner, Mario Rojas invested P 15,000 to his newly opened business.

2 - Purchased merchandise on account from National Suppliers, P 8,000 – terms: 2/10, n/30, FOB, Shipping Point – P 220.

4 - Purchased store supplies in cash, P 1,600.

6 - Received credit refund from National Suppliers due to merchandise with defects, P 200.

7 - Sold merchandise on account P 4,400 – terms: 2/10, n/30, FOB Destination – P 110.

10 - Purchased store equipment worth P 18,000, terms: 2/10, n/30.

12 - Paid National Suppliers in full.

13 - Purchased merchandise in cash, P 3,700

14 - Received a cash loan from United Bank on a promissory note of P 15,000.

15 - Received refund from supplier for poor quality merchandise on cash purchase, P 430.

17 - Received collections in full from customer billed on May 7.

18 - Purchased merchandise from PDP Distributors for P 2,500 – terms: 2/10, n/30.

19 - Paid freight on May 18 purchase, P 125.

20 - Paid half the amount due to the store equipment bought on May 10.

21 - The owner withdrew P 3,000 cash for his personal use.

23 - Sold merchandise on account, P 2,400.

25 - Purchased merchandise from CMD Trading, P 2,350 – terms: 2/10, n/30

28 - Paid PDP Distributors in full.

29 - Sold merchandise for cash, P 5,400. FOB, Destination – P250.

30 - Paid the salary of store staff, P 2,000.

31 - Made refunds to cash customers for defective merchandise, P 324.

•At the end of May, it was determined that ending inventory was P 8,300.
